iOS 安装神器:了解苹果签名的前提知识
想要在你的 iOS 设备上安装第三方应用?或者想要给别人分享你的应用?那么你需要了解 iOS 签名。
什么是 iOS 签名?
iOS 签名是苹果对应用的授权机制,它可以防止未经授权的应用安装和运行。在你下载任何应用之前,苹果都会检查它是否已经被签名,如果没有签名,那么应用无法通过验证,就无法被安装和执行。
苹果签名的类型
苹果签名有三种类型:开发者签名、企业签名和 App Store 签名。
开发者签名主要是为了让开发者调试和测试应用时可以在真实设备上运行。每个开发者都有一个开发者证书和一个私钥,这些工具用于签名应用。开发者签名是免费的,但是需要你在苹果开发者网站上注册并获取证书才能使用。
企业签名通常用于公司内部分发 iOS 应用,使得员工可以在不受限制的情况下使用企业应用。企业签名需要向苹果支付一定的费用。
App Store 签名是苹果用来管理在 App Store 上的应用。只有经过苹果严格审核的应用才能在 App Store 上发布。这些应用被 Apple 签名,并且会被分配唯一的 bundle ID,并且可以批量发布。
![iOS 安装神器了解苹果签名的前提知识](https://www.crallw.com/wp-content/themes/module/themer/assets/images/lazy.png)
如何签名 iOS 应用?
为了将 iOS 应用进行签名,你需要使用苹果的 Xcode 工具。Xcode 自带了一组工具,可以帮助你在开发时和发布时进行签名和打包。
对于开发者签名和企业签名,你需要在应用打包时将应用签名。对于 App Store 签名,你需要将应用上传到 iTunes Connect,然后等待 Apple 的审查。
在打包和签名过程中,你需要生成一个证书,然后使用该证书对应用进行签名。证书可以在苹果开发者网站上获取,证书过期后需要进行更新。为了使用证书,你需要在 Keychain Access 工具中将其导入,并确保选中了证书和私钥。
使用 iOS 安装神器进行签名
如果你想完全省去这些繁琐的签名步骤,你可以考虑使用一些第三方的 iOS 安装神器。这些神器可以帮助你绕过开发者签名和企业签名的限制,让你快速地安装任何应用程序。
不过需要注意的是,这些神器可能会侵犯苹果的安全政策,从而被官方禁止使用。如果发现你的设备或账户存在违规行为,则可能会导致应用无法更新或甚至账户被封禁。
??论
iOS 签名是苹果对应用的授权机制之一,它可以防止未经授权的应用安装和运行。开发者签名、企业签名和 App Store 签名是现有的主要签名类型。如果你想省去繁琐的签名步骤,可以考虑使用一些第三方的 iOS 安装神器,但是需要注意遵守官方安全政策。